Snake Plant Thin Leaves - GardensOfMine
WebThe only way to do away with your Snake Plant’s long and skinny foliage is to clip it off. However, if you trim off all the plant’s leaves at once, you’ll deprive it of the ability to photosynthesize, and it will take a lot longer to send up new growth. We recommend snipping only the most severely leggy leaves at first. WebReasons For Snake Plants Became Thin Mainly because there wasn’t much sunlight. Roots that are clogged up can also cause thinning because the plant can’t grow as smoothly.
